Genesis lawsuit alleges DCG ‘alter ego’ scheme, ignored warnings

A newly unsealed complaint reveals DCG executives anticipated legal fallout and ignored risk warnings as Genesis spiraled toward collapse.

A newly unsealed complaint from bankrupt crypto lender Genesis reveals internal communications at its parent company, Digital Currency Group (DCG), suggested executives were aware of financial mismanagement and looming legal risks tied to their control over Genesis.

According to the Delaware Court of Chancery filing, DCG’s chief financial officer, Michael Kraines, acknowledged the risk that Genesis could be deemed DCG’s “alter ego.”

In a confidential memo shared with former Genesis CEO Michael Moro and others, Kraines laid out a “war-gaming exercise” preparing for legal arguments a future plaintiff might raise if Genesis collapsed. The memo, attached to the complaint, mirrors claims now central to the lawsuit.
